Last Listing description (June 2022)

Tasteful Glenroy Home

Situated in a quiet complex of just four, freestanding townhouses, 4/965 Burrows Road delivers private solitude with a generous yard space backing green belt.

The two storey design comprises open plan lounge, family and kitchen areas which flow to the generous undercover porch overlooking the garden and greenbelt with creek beyond. The kitchen offers dishwasher, gas cooking, walk in pantry and ample bench space.

Accommodation includes three bedrooms. One bedroom and bathroom are located on the lower level, whilst upstairs plays host to bedrooms two and three, and a second bathroom & separate bathroom.

Car storage includes an extra-long garage with internal access, as well as two car spaces. Double gate access to the back yard and an additional garden shed is perfect for extra storage if required. Lawns & gardening maintenance included in advertised price.

Reverse cycle air conditioning throughout, an abundance of space. Positioned within steps to local schools, sporting grounds and golf course, as well as easy connection to Albury CBD.

About Glenroy 2640

The size of Glenroy is approximately 8.0 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 11.7% of total area. The population of Glenroy in 2016 was 3289 people. By 2021 the population was 3528 showing a population growth of 7.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Glenroy is 50-59 years. Households in Glenroy are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Glenroy work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.30% of the homes in Glenroy were owner-occupied compared with 73.20% in 2016.

Glenroy has 1,787 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Glenroy have seen a 91.26%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 62.66%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Glenroy is $667,526 while the median value for Units is $392,543.
  • Houses have a median rent of $530 while Units have a median rent of $420.
